(09-19-2012 08:02 AM)Willem53 Wrote: PCH is Linux, MAC is IOS and the rest is Windows. No, Mac is OSX. iphone/ipad are IOS. OSX is a Unix derivative (based on BSD). Linux is also a Unix derivative. (09-19-2012 08:02 AM)Willem53 Wrote: SMB (Samba) is a protocol that allows the rest of the world to read and write to Linux filesystems. SMB is a service provided by the NMT so the Absolutely not. Unix world uses NFS (Network File System). It is native, and part of the kernel. It is also Open, and precisely defined by RFC. SMB is a Microsoft (Windows) attempt on a network file system. It is a behemoth, takes 12 packet exchanges to do simple auth. It was not documented publicly, and had to be (initially) reverse-engineered to add SMB support to Unix systems. It is separate to the kernel, and runs in userland (some flavours of Linux can has moderate kernel support). The reverse engineered SMB had questionable licensing. Apple chose to implement in-house version of SMB to get around that. Due to Microsoft not publishing SMB changes between Windows versions, there is a noticeable lag for the Open implementations to be updated and add approximated support. (09-19-2012 08:02 AM)Willem53 Wrote: So in short it is not the PCH that needs SMB...... this is of course talking from a non Apple centric worldview point This is true. SMB was added to handle those users who have made the poor decision to go with Windows. Since you will not (easily) be able to use NFS, or UPNP. You are forced(-ish) to use SMB. And generally, Windows users are not smart enough to figure out how to install NFS or UPNP support. Note here: Unix has NFS, SMB and UPNP. OSX has NFS, SMB, UPNP. Windows has SMB. Lund |

RE: Mountain Lion issues?
don't worry we are easy
![]() are you screwed?....... No the apple discussion forum has some temporary workarounds and the easy way is using FTP. Start the FTP service on the A100 and use a apple FTP client to transfer the files up or down. Bug is with apple, looks like it moved from 16KB to 2KB so short paths work long paths fail.
